LAND OF VOLCANOES (The ring of fire):

The expedition through the Land of Fire. In this special tour you will experience 3 of the most iconic volcanoes in Central America. A guided hike to the top of Acatenango volcano, which will take you up to 13,00ft /4000m high, above the clouds, and with the second most active volcano just in front, you will experience a show like no other, truly unique in this world. After, we will come down to start our way to the black volcanic sand beaches of the Pacific ocean where we will take a tour through the mangroves, full of beautiful birds and turtles. Our final destination will be Pacaya volcano, the most active volcano in Guatemala, with the opportunity to see the lava rivers and the frozen magma which make this location so special. Get ready to have an experience like no other that you will only find in Guatemala, the heart of the Mayan Civilization, a land of fire.

Day 2: Antigua - Acatenango volcano

Antigua, home to the first capital of Central America and an UNESCO protected site due to its cultural heritage and history, will be the starting point for this expedition. Having an early rise and breakfast, we will head on our way to Acatenango volcano, the start of this great volcano adventure!

Starting our way in La Soledad, we will start to walk our way up the volcano, as we start ascending  the volcano, you will be able to notice the change in the climate first going from hot, then to tropical humid setting, for then arriving at the top part, a cold climate with amazing views. The 6h hike will surely give you a good workout so when we arrive at camp you can enjoy the view together with a mountain cooked delicious meal made to recover you from all the hard effort. Hopefully we will see some of the eruptions before going to bed and resting for the next day.

Day 3: Acatenango Volcano - El Paredon Beach

Waking up early, we will commence our hike to summit Acatenango volcano, arriving at the top, right by sunrise. We will be rewarded with a beautiful sight of a great part of Guatemala, if it is clear we will be having the view at a chain of 7 volcanoes, Lake Atitlan, and the Pacific Coast. You will be on top of the 3rd highest volcano in Central America and you will enjoy a warm and delicious breakfast there as well.

After we have finished appreciating the view, we will come down and then we will start our way down the volcano. Once down, we will enjoy lunch and now we will be on the way to the beach. You can have a nap in the car if you like or enjoy the 2h road to our next destination, El Paredon!

El Paredon, here we will dedicate the rest of the day to relax, get in the sea, soak up some sun and have a delicious dinner to recover from the past day. Early sleep and the sound of waves will make us rest like never before in these beautiful black sand beaches of the Pacific coast.

Day 4: Manglar - Pacaya Active Volcano

Rising up early, we will have a fresh breakfast and get ready for our adventure into the manglar of the Pacific coast. A tour that will take us around 4h to get really into the insides and the untouched nature of this place. Navigating through the canals we will be able to see wildlife and nature in a very specific and beautiful environment.

Once back at the starting point, lunch will be waiting for us and the vehicles ready to transport us to the next location, Volcan de Pacaya! Two hours and a half on the road will take us to the most active volcano in Central America. Having arrived, a short 4x4 drive through the frozen lava will take us to the ground where our campsite will be. We will have some free time to explore the area and if we are lucky enough we will be able to see the lava rivers.

Dinner will be served and as the night comes in we will start to enjoy the night at one of the best places in Guatemala for stargazing, we will take out the portable telescope, and let the show begin. Fire, magma and a sky filled with stars will be your companions for this last evening through the volcanoes of Guatemala, the heart of the Mayan world and the belt of fire.
